H411 EEW is a 1991 Citroen Ax in Grey with a 1,124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 1991 Citroen Ax models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.0% with a typical mileage of 79,414 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Citroen Ax fails its MOT is brake hose excessively deteriorated, accounting for 29,403 recorded failures. If you're considering buying H411 EEW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en Ax typ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 35 years old, this Citroen Ax is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
